I have slightly different perspective on this.

Girls getting married at the age of 15-16-17 is unfortunately quite common thing in our society.. In almost every village or in economically backward sections in most of the cities, you can see such cases. Simple because either they can't afford to get the girls educated further, they don't understand the importance of education, the girls themselves are not interested in continuing education, or there is a mentality that a girl should be married off as early as possible. Likely to be as in the example that you have given.

Child marriage as a custom or tradition is different side of the story, where both the boy and girl can be married off in an age as early as 8/9 or even before that.. Here the kids won't even understand the meaning of marriage, so there is no question of them entering into it willingly or unwillingly.
